Lo Piot Priorat Francesca Vicent Robert

The lowdown

  • To look at: Deep, dark ruby with quite an amount of sediment – what looks like big bits of grape skin.
  • Night 1: Smells and tastes of leather, black cherry
  • Night 2: Leather has mellowed out, more vanilla with black cherry and blackcurrant
  • Overall: really delicious, highly recommended

Details on the Lo Piot 2002

  • Made by Francesca Vicent Robert
  • Interesting factoid: on the label it’s DOQ, or Denominació d’Origen Qualificada – Catalan rather than the Spanish Denominación de Origen Calificada)
  • 90% Garnacha (Grenache), 10% Cabernet Sauvignon
  • 1500 cases made (18,000 bottles)
  • 12 Months in French Oak Barrels
  • 14.5% ABV
  • Price: about €22

Priorat, the area

Priorat is located in Catalonia. The “Lo Piot” is made in Gratallops (see on a Google map).
